Optus Killarney Tri - A big day out!

11 Dec 2022 by Ian Barnes

We have just wrapped up from the Optus Killarney Tri, and what a big day it was. We had 121 people get involved across all of our events today, which was a stellar turn out.

Firstly – to give a big congratulations to everyone who completed their first triathlon today! How good did that feel, so many smiles across the line which was fantastic to see. We had 24 participants in our short course non-competitive event today, a mix of experienced triathletes coming out of hiatus, first timers and some team challenges going on. Well done to everyone. Proving the Short Course is for anyone, we even had a TT bike with race wheels out on course today 😉

Into the sprint distance events – in our women’s category, Gab Lanman took the honors today, with Liv Morgan in hot pursuit. Karen Benson back from injury took out an impressive third place. The men’s was a hot contest from the start today, the lead changing between Joey Coote and Adam Cashmore, Cashy able to catch up and pip him in the last lap of the run to cross the line first. Brett Trace a regular to our club events crossed the line in 3rd position. Its always great to see the Teams out on course and today “Trifecta” came across the line in first place, “Kelly’s Heroes” across in second, followed in by “Norm and Libby”. Well done to all 5 teams who took on the challenge. To see all the full results of todays Open events, click onto the Results Tab.

Following on, we then had 43 kids complete the tri events today – the Under 7’s kicking off first, with the littles getting confidence out on course with each event they return to do. Then moving onto the 7-9s and 10-12s out on the road and challenging themselves with a run around the oval to finish off. It was great to see so many of our previous U7s from last season stepping up and mixing it with the 7-9 kids this year in the ‘big’ event.
